Varun Vakharia Wins the 2015 Elias Klein Founders’ Travel Supplement Award

 

Varun Vakharia, a Ph.D. student in Winston Ho’s group, has been selected as a winner of the 2015 Elias Klein Founders’ Travel Supplement Award from the North American Membrane Society (NAMS).  The selection of this award is based, in part, on academic achievements, and it will provide up to $500 for Varun to present a paper, entitled “Water Vapor and CO2; Permeation through Amine-Containing Facilitated Transport Membranes and Their Modeling for CO2 Separation”, at the Annual Meeting of NAMS in Boston, MA on May 31 – June 3, 2015.
